Runbook: Nightfill scheduler operations. Nightfill launches backfill jobs at 02:00 local to the Harlow cluster, partitioned by tenant shard. Before approving changes to the scheduler config, verify that the job lease table is empty of stale locks and that the previous night's run completed; a partial run must be resumed, never restarted, or duplicate rows will land in the aggregates. Lease state, run history, and checkpoint offsets all live in the coordination database, reachable via the connection string below.

replica DSN, yahaf-yagaf: mongodb://tamath_svc:a2netSk3RZMuTj@db-d084.novacsoft.internal:5432/ralmir

## Ownership

The ParityScope rate-parity checker compares published hotel rates across the Driftline and Homestead channels hourly and flags discrepancies above the configured tolerance. Reviewers should note that the scraper adapters and the tolerance engine have separate test suites; changes to either require a green run of both. All design decisions and merge approvals for this module trace back to the maintainer named below.

named custodian: Brivan Eliath Quenox Frador

Q: Can I use the goods lift at Pelton Yard? A: Only if you're moving actual deliveries — it's reserved for couriers and facilities, so no sneaky shortcuts with your lunch. If you do have a legit bulky delivery to move, book a slot with the post room first. The lift panel is code-locked, and the current access code is:

door code, tahof-yajog: bdg-C-65